The advancement of ICT has resulted in the fast development of games industry by which teachers are creative to design the learning process and to utilize various kinds of gamifications. Gamification is a teaching method that uses game elements with the aim of motivating students to be directly involved in games and learning at the same time so that students get an interesting and enjoyable learning experience. Although many studies have been conducted related to the use gamification, the study on the use of gamification to improve tenses mastery regarded the students� creativity is rarely found. This study was aimed to investigate whether: (1) gamification was more effective than conventional teaching method in enhancing tenses mastery of the second semester students of nursing diploma III; (2) the second semester students with high level of creativity had better tenses mastery than those with low level of creativity; and (3) there was an interaction effect between teaching methods and creativity on enhancing tenses mastery of the second semester students of nursing diploma III of faculty of health of Universitas Harapan Bangsa. The method which was employed in this research was an experimental research. The population of the research was the second semester students of nursing diploma III of faculty of health of Universitas Harapan Bangsa. Two classes were taken by using total sampling technique. The samples in this research were two classes; experimental class consisting of 30 students from 2A-1 and control class consisting of 30 students from 2A-2. The research instruments consisted of verbal creativity and tenses mastery test. The data were obtained from creativity and tenses mastery test. They were analysed in the terms of their frequency distribution, normality of the sample distribution, and the data homogeneity and then ANOVA test (Multifactor Analysis and Variance) and TUKEY test to test the research hypotheses. The result of the research findings leads to the conclusion that: (1) gamification is more effective than conventional teaching method to enhance tenses mastery of the second semester students; (2) the students having high creativity have better tenses mastery than those having low creativity; and (3) there is an interaction between teaching methods and creativity on enhancing tenses mastery.

The study investigated the effects of out-door activities on students’ attitude towards learning of Physics in Senior Secondary School Physics in Ekiti State, Nigeria. The research design adopted in the study was Pretest-Posttest Quasi-experimental. The sample for the study was 150 Senior Secondary One (SSI) Physics students (this sample was divided into the experimental and control groups in ratio 1: 1 i.e. 75 in each group), selected through the multistage sampling technique from a total population of 7,852 SS I students offering Physics in all the 184 public Senior Secondary Schools in Ekiti State. The instrument used to collect relevant data from the subjects was Physics Attitudinal Scale (PAS). The reliability of the instrument was determined through the split-half method with the reliability coefficient of 0.83. Two null hypotheses were tested at 0.05 level of significance. The data collected were analysed using inferential statistics of t-test and Analysis of Covariance (ANCOVA). The results of the analyses showed that there was significant difference in the attitude of students to Physics in the experimental and control groups in favour of experimental group. Based on the findings of the study, it was recommended that non-conventional teaching approaches such as using out-door activities, should be introduced into the teaching of Physics in the nation’s secondary schools to reinforce the hitherto adopted conventional teaching method and Physics teachers should be encouraged to make use of these new teaching approaches.

The main objective of this study is to identify the effectiveness of teaching methods in teaching English language through figures of speech. Thirty-one figures of speech were selected from different prose adverse lines for the study.  The study was experimental in nature and the pretest-post test control group research design was adopted among 120 bachelor third year education students from five campuses of Makawanpur District, Nepal. Simple random sampling technique was used to select the students to form the Control Group and the Experimental Group which were taught by using the lecture teaching method and the discussion teaching method respectively for thirty five days. The paired samples t test in SPSS Version 20 was used to compare Total Pretest Mean Score and Total Posttest Mean Score within groups. The overall reliability of the instruments based on the posttest scores of the students of the both groups of the pilot study was .979 and that of the research study was .968.  The pair samples t test between the Total Pretest Mean Score and the Total Posttest Mean Score of the Control Group (observed t- value=20.652, critical t- value= 2.001 and p< .05) and the Experimental Group (observed t- value= 42.907, critical t- value= 2.001 and p< .05) show that there was a statistically significant difference between the Total Pretest Mean Score and the Total Posttest Mean Score in each group. It justifies that the lecture teaching method and the discussion teaching method were effective within each group.

<p>This paper reports the ongoing project related to the development of mobile-based learning application particularly for Alpha Generations who studies in international school. Due to the advancement of digital technologies, Alpha Generations tend to interact with mobile device compared to conventional environment as they were born in the century of digital age. This includes their learning activities. In Malaysia, expert in language literacy particularly Malay language is compulsory for all including foreigner students who learn in international school. As the mobile-based learning application could provide attractive and interactive interaction compared to conventional teaching method, providing children with additional mobile-based learning tool could facilitates them to have their own active learning experience. This study found that this is the research gap that should be fill in to ensure children in international school able to literate in Malay Language similar to mainstream student. Therefore, mobile-based learning application called BM Year 2 has been developed and evaluated. The proposed application also has been discussed in the previous paper which involves expert evaluation. To ensure the proposed application could fulfill the actual users’ needs, user experience testing has been carried out and discusses in this paper.They are tested in terms of layout and design, functionality, and user’s satisfaction. A set of questionnaires has been set up and distributed to the actual users upon they use the proposed mobile-based learning application BM Year 2. Overall, the empirical findings found that theBM Year 2 able to evokepositive learning experience to the actual users.  <strong></strong></p>

The study investigated the effectiveness of Co-operative E-learning approach (CELA) on students’ attitude towards Chemistry. The Solomon Four Group, Non-equivalent Control Group Design was employed in the study. The study was carried out in Koibatek sub-county, Kenya where there has been a persistent low achievement in the subject. 489 form three students from twelve county schools, purposively selected from the sub-county were taught the same course content on the mole for a period of five weeks. The experiment groups received their instructions through the use of CELA approach and control groups using the conventional teaching method. The researcher trained the teachers in the experimental groups on the technique of CELA before treatment. Student Attitude Questionnaire (SAQ) was used for data collection. The results of the study indicated that students in experimental groups outperformed those in the control groups. Also, there were no statistically significant differences in the mean score in SAQ between boys and girls exposed to CELA. Girls and boys performed equally well in altitudes towards Chemistry. Chemistry teachers should be encouraged to incorporate CELA method.

This research is a quasi-experimental aims to identify the effect of problem-based learning model using virtual simulation media towards the students’ concept mastery and creativity in physics. The design of this research used of non-equivalent control group design, while the sampling technique used purposive sampling. The population of this research is all students of grade X SMAN 2 Mataram, while the sampling are the students of grade X-3 as the experimental group and the students of grade X-4 as control group. The data obtained in this research is  data mastery of concept and creativity. The research hypothesis was tested using t-test polled variances. The test result showed that the N-gain mastery of concepts has increased in each sub material and the highest increase in the sub matter theory of electromagnetic waves. Values of N-gain experimental group in the high category (71%) and control group in the medium category (53%). T-test showed that the model is applied to significant influence on improving students’ mastery of concepts and creativity, higher in the experimental group compared with the control group. Increased figural creativity higher than verbal creativity in both classes

This study is conducted to investigate whether there was a significant effect of English comics on students‟ vocabulary achievement. The research question of this study was “is there any significant effect of English comics on students‟ vocabulary achievement at SMPN 10 Kendari?” The design of this study was quasi experimental design that consists of experimental class and control class. The sample of this study are students at class VIII 3 and VIII 4 in SMP Negeri 10 Kendari who register in academic year 2016/2017 with the total number of sample are 56 students, 27 for control class and 29 for experimental class. The instrument of this study is a vocabulary test. The researcher collects the data by giving pre test in two classes to know students ability, giving treatment which  the researcher conducted teaching and learning process by using English comics in experimental class and using no media (conventional teaching method) in control class, giving post test to know students‟ vocabulary achievement after being taught by using comics compared with the result in class that taught by conventional teaching media. The researcher used an Independent sample T-test in SPSS verse 20 to analyze the result of the research. An independent sample t-test was conducted to compare the gain scores in experimental and control class. There was a significant difference in the scores for experimental class (M= 2.02, SD= 2.03) and control class (M= 0.94, SD= 1.32) conditions; p= 0.02 Sig. <α or H0  is rejected and H1  is accepted.  Thus,  it  can be said  that  using English  comics  has  increased  the  students‟  vocabulary achievement. The effect of English comics can increase students‟ vocabulary achievement at second year students‟ of SMPN 10 Kendari. Keywords : English comics, Vocabulary Achievement, Media in Learning

Introduction: The successful teaching program comprises of well planned curriculum along with its effective execution system, with the intention that the students acquire maximum significant knowledge in the available time-span. A teaching method consists of the principles and technique used for instruction. The methodology of teaching a topic will influence the students, in the comprehension of the subject as well as in the management of clinical conditions. The very certain fact is; students are undoubtedly in the best position to comment on the effectiveness of any the teaching and evaluation methods. Objective: To evaluate the different teaching methods practiced in physiology using student’s feedback. Material And Methods: A written questionnaire covering topics on various teaching and evaluation methods was used to get feedback from students. Descriptive statistics was used for analysis of data. Frequency was shown as percentage. Results : Most of the students (55%) preferred combination of conventional & advanced methods to make lectures effective. Practical sessions of clinical examination are most interesting (70%) Conclusion: Students were satisfied with all teaching methods with certain suggestions. Relevant modifications in the curriculum of physiology as well as other medical subjects must be made time to time according to students need.

The study aims to reveal the effectiveness of chemistry scrabble game as a learning media for colloidal systems in senior high school. This research is a continuation of research from development research. This type research is quasi-experimental. The population was all students of XI IPA (even semester) 2019 till 2020 at senior high school (SMA N 1) Batang Kapas. This research used 2 classes, the sampling technique is a purposive sampling technique. This research instrument used were student learning outcome. N-Gain value of the experimental class 0.85 (high category) and control class 0,71 (high category), Based on results t-test obtained tcount = 2,77 and ttable = 1,67 it was the chemical scrabble game effectively improved learning outcomes with a high level.
